|a Adriaan Neele presents the first comprehensive study of Jonathan Edwards's use of Reformed orthodox and Protestant scholastic primary sources in the context of the challenges of orthodoxy in his day. Despite the breadth of new scholarship about the post-Edwards era, little analysis has been dedicated to his use of primary sources.
